#2c6e9d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c6e9d is composed of 17.3% red, 43.1%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72% cyan, 29.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 205 degrees, a saturation of 56.2% and a lightness of 39.4%. #2c6e9d color hex could be obtained by blending #58dcff with #00003b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#2c6e9d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c6e9d has RGB values of R:44, G:110,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 2911901.
